France edge Belgium with late own goal to reach Euro 2024 quarter-finals

France booked their spot in the Euro 2024 quarter-finals courtesy of a late own goal by Belgium’s Jan Vertonghen.
Having scored just two goals at Euro 2024 before today’s game, courtesy of an own goal and a penalty, Vertonghen’s unfortunate error was France’s ticket to the next stage.
In a dramatic turn of events at Düsseldorf Arena, the game featured few moments of brilliance and appeared to be heading for extra time until Vertonghen deflected Randal Kolo Muani’s strike into the net, handing Les Bleus the victory.
France squandered numerous opportunities as they continue to struggle to get their attack firing in this competition.
Captain Kylian Mbappe was not left out, as he also failed to convert chances that he typically buries with ease.
Belgium, on the other hand, had their moments and came close when Kevin De Bruyne made a brilliant run into open space, only to see his shot brilliantly saved by goalkeeper Mike Maignan.
France, who failed to top their group for the first time in 12 years, will face the winner between Portugal and Slovenia.
